=== TB REACH 4 ===
Contributors: IHS, IRD-Pakistan, IRD-South Africa
Software Type: Free, Open-source
Requires: Microsoft Windows 7 or higher, Oracle Java Runtime Environment (JRE) v6.0 or higher, Eclipse Helios or higher, Apache Tomcat 6.0, MySQL Server 5.0 or higher
License: GPLv3

== Description ==
tbreach4_pk: TB REACH wave 4 aims to control TB and drug-resistant TB in rural areas of Sindh, Pakistan with the collaboration of local health facilities by contact tracing of Adult and reverse contact tracing of Paediatric TB cases
tbreach4_sa: Also called MINE-TB, the project focuses on reducing TB burden in several locations of Port Shepstone, South Africa by involving community mobilizers

4. Enabling SSL encryption on Tomcat
a. nano /var/lib/tomcat6/conf/server.xml
b. Search and uncomment the commented block for configuring SSL HTTP connector (by default, it's on port 8443)
 <Connector port="8443" protocol="HTTP/1.1" SSLEnabled="true"
               maxThreads="150" scheme="https" secure="true"
               clientAuth="false" sslProtocol="TLS" />
c. Set protocol="org.apache.coyote.http11.Http11NioProtocol", add keystoreFile="/home/myhome/IHSCertificate.cert" and password (if provided while creating the certificate)
    <Connector port="8443" protocol="org.apache.coyote.http11.Http11NioProtocol" SSLEnabled="true"
               maxThreads="150" scheme="https" secure="true"
               clientAuth="false" sslProtocol="TLS" 
               keystoreFile="/home/myhome/ihscertificate.cer" 
               keystorePass="mysslcertificatepassword" />
d. Save the file and exit the editor
e. service tomcat6 restart
f. In the browser, goto "https://localhost:8443"
g. If the browser warns about untrusted source. Ignore and proceed by adding the website as an exception.

7. Restricting OpenMRS to HTTPS only
a. nano /var/lib/tomcat6/webapps/openmrs/WEB-INF/web.xml
b. Add the following text at the end, just before ending tag:
<security-constraint>
	<web-resource-collection>
		<web-resource-name>HTTPSOnly</web-resource-name>
		<url-pattern>/*</url-pattern>
	</web-resource-collection>
	<user-data-constraint>
		<transport-guarantee>CONFIDENTIAL</transport-guarantee>
	</user-data-constraint>
</security-constraint>
c. service tomcat6 restart

8. Troubleshooting memory leak issue
- nano /var/lib/tomcat6/conf/web.xml file
- In the jsp servlet definition add the following element:
<init-param>
	<param-name>enablePooling</param-name>
	<param-value>false</param-value>
</init-param>
- If the above doesn't work out, try the following:
- nano /etc/init.d/tomcat6
- Change (~line 81):

FROM:
if [ -z "$JAVA_OPTS" ]; then
        JAVA_OPTS="-Djava.awt.headless=true -Xmx128M"
fi

TO:

if [ -z "$JAVA_OPTS" ]; then
        JAVA_OPTS="-Djava.awt.headless=true -Xmx1024M -Xms1024M -XX:PermSize=256m -XX:MaxPermSize=256m -XX:NewSize=128m"
fi
